> The marshall method for the ExtensibleAttribute subclass doesn't reuse the base class method for probably ill-advised reasons, and now it's out of sync and losing track of the set of attribute names attached to the attribute. This wouldn't be a big deal if not for the horrible code used to rename attributes pulled from metadata.
